    @gt12 they have been far more competitive than I thought they would ever have been ..i spoke to Dale McLeod during the week and he told me that many of these boys have apart from a handful have never experienced full time professional environments pertaining to many aspects including everyday training , eating correctly and more importantly being supported as individuals…
    He actually said many of these boys who have been part of NPC squads have felt on the outer and being part of MP they have been far more inclusive..
    Dale reckoned it’s the best environment he’s ever been part of , they only problem they have now is the number of pacific island players wanting to be part of this and of course the NZ franchises that are already expressing interest in some of their current players .
